KAWASAKI ZX-10/ZZR 1000 997 (1988 - 1990) Description & History: Manufactured between 1988 and 1990, the ZZR 1000 is a sport bike which has a liquid cooled, four strokes, four cylinders engine with a displacement of 997cc.
KAWASAKI ZX-10/ZZR 1000 997 1988 - 1990 Full Specifications:Brand: KAWASAKI, Model: ZZR, Type: ZX-10/ZZR 1000 1988, Name Year: ZX-10/ZZR 1000 997 1988 - 1990, Engine Type: Liquid cooled, four strokes, transverse four cylinders, 4 valves per cylinder, Displacement: 997 cm3, Bore Xstroke: 2.9x2.2 in OR 73.7x55.9 mm, Compression: 11:1, Horsepower: 101(137)/10000 KW(hp)/RPM, Torque: 76/9000 lb-ft/RPM OR 103/9000 Nm/RPM, Fuel System: Keihin carburetors, Gearbox: 6 Speed, Clutch: -, Primary Drive: -, Final Drive: Chain, Frame: -, Front Suspension: Telescopic forks, Rear Suspension: Uni-track monoshock, Front Brake: Dual 300 mm discs, Rear Brake: Single 250 mm disc, Length: -, Width: -, Seat Height: -, Wellbase: -, Ground Clearance: -, Weight: 575 lbs OR 261 kg, Fuel Capacity: 5.8 gallons OR 5.8 L, Tyres Front: 120/70-17, Tyres Rear: 160/60-18.
